About the Dyson DC14:
The Dyson DC14 is one of Dyson’s original vacuum cleaners. The vacuum is available new & used from different online Realtors, but this model is no longer available form the company direct. The DC14 was one of the original vacuums to help Dyson become one of the world’s leading vacumm manufacturers.
About the Dyson DC33:
The Dyson DC33 is the latest vacuum in Dyson’s lineup. The new vacuum is equipped with all of Dyson’s standard features including the Dyson Cyclone, Hygenienic Cylinder, & Lifetime Hepa Filter. The newest feature to be added to the DC33 is a longer extendible wand. Athough a longer wand will make cleaning high ceilings and behind furniture easier than it would be with the DC14 the offset in price may mean a whole lot more to you.
